Abacavir Sulfate Explained: An In-Depth Look

Wiki Article

Abacavir sulfate is a pharmaceutical drug utilized in the treatment of Human Immunodeficiency Virus (HIV). It operates as a nucleoside reverse transcriptase inhibitor (NRTI), hindering the ability of HIV to replicate within cells. Abacavir sulfate is typically prescribed in combination with other antiretroviral medications for optimal effectiveness.

Abiraterone Acetate in Oncology Treatment

Abiraterone acetate acts as a synthetic copyright hormone inhibitor commonly utilized for the treatment of advanced prostate cancer. It works by blocking an enzyme known as 17-alpha-hydroxylase, which is essential for the production of testosterone. By inhibiting this enzyme, abiraterone acetate reduces testosterone levels systemically, thus slowing or stopping the growth of prostate cancer cells.

Grasping the CAS Numbers for Pharmaceutical Compounds

CAS Numbers are fundamental identifiers used in the pharmaceutical industry to distinctly identify chemical materials. These digital codes, assigned by the Chemical Abstracts Service (CAS), provide a consistent system for translating information about pharmaceutical components globally. By leveraging CAS Numbers, researchers, manufacturers, and regulators can efficiently access critical data on a substance's properties, safety profile, and targeted applications.
